K963275 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the RELISA ENA SINGLE WELL SCREEN ANTIBODY TEST SYSTEM. Classified as Extractable Antinuclear Antibody, Antigen And Control (product code LLL),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Immuno Concepts, Inc. (Dallas,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on September 13, 1996 after a review of 24 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.

This device falls under the Immunology F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 866.5100 - the FDA immunology device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
